儿童编程入门先学什么好呢
-
儿童编程入门,以下几个方面是比较重要的学习内容:
-
认识计算机:首先,要让儿童对计算机有一个基本的了解,包括计算机的组成部分、硬件设备和软件程序的概念。可以通过实际操作计算机,了解各个组成部分的功能和作用。
-
算法思维:在学习编程之前,儿童需要了解算法思维的概念。算法思维是指解决问题的一种思考方式,包括问题分解、模式识别、抽象和逻辑推理等。可以通过一些适合儿童的游戏来培养儿童的算法思维能力。
-
编程语言:选择适合儿童的编程语言进行学习,比如Scratch、Python等。Scratch是一种图形化编程语言,适合初学者,可以让儿童通过拖拽编程块的方式进行编程。Python是一种文本化编程语言,适合进一步深入学习。可以通过在线编程平台或者编程教育机构提供的课程进行学习。
-
基本编程概念:儿童需要学习一些基本的编程概念,比如变量、循环、条件语句等。可以通过编程游戏或者编程任务来学习这些概念,并进行实际的编程练习。
-
项目实践:最后,儿童还可以通过一些小项目来应用所学的编程知识,比如制作一个简单的游戏、设计一个交互界面等。这样可以让儿童将所学的知识应用于实际情境中,提高编程能力。
总之,儿童编程入门,需要先了解计算机的基本知识,培养算法思维能力,选择适合儿童的编程语言进行学习,学习基本的编程概念,并进行项目实践。通过这样的学习过程,儿童可以逐步掌握编程的基本技能,为进一步深入学习打下坚实的基础。
1年前 -
-
儿童编程入门有很多不同的学习路径,但是以下几个方面是值得关注和学习的。
-
算法思维:算法思维是编程的基础,儿童编程的入门阶段应该注重培养儿童的逻辑思维和问题解决能力。可以从一些简单的问题开始,让儿童思考如何分解问题、设计解决方案。
-
编程概念:学习编程的第一步是理解编程的基本概念,例如变量、循环、条件语句等。可以通过一些简单的编程语言或者编程工具来学习,例如Scratch或者Code.org。这些工具通常采用图形化编程界面,适合儿童入门学习。
-
程序设计思维:学习编程还需要培养儿童的程序设计思维,即如何将问题分解为小的子问题,设计合适的算法和数据结构。可以通过解决一些简单的问题或者编写小游戏来培养这种思维能力。
-
硬件编程:硬件编程是一个有趣且实用的学习领域,儿童可以通过学习如何编写控制硬件的代码来提高对编程的兴趣和理解。例如,学习如何使用Arduino板或者Micro:bit等硬件来编写程序。这样不仅可以学习编程,还可以培养儿童的实验能力。
-
团队合作和创意表达:在编程的过程中,儿童可以尝试与其他人一起合作,通过合作解决问题和完成项目。这有助于培养儿童的团队合作能力和沟通交流能力。同时,编程也是一种创意表达的方式,儿童可以尝试设计自己的作品并展示给他人。
总的来说,儿童编程入门应该注重培养算法思维、编程概念、程序设计思维、硬件编程、团队合作和创意表达等能力。通过适当的学习路径和方法,可以帮助儿童建立起对编程的兴趣和基本的编程能力。
1年前 -
-
儿童编程是培养儿童逻辑思维、创造力和解决问题能力的一种方法。对于初学者,从简单的概念和基本的编程原理开始学习是很重要的。下面是一些建议的学习内容:
-
认识计算机:介绍计算机的基本概念,包括硬件、软件和操作系统等。让孩子了解计算机的组成和工作原理。
-
学习算法和逻辑思维:算法是解决问题的一系列步骤。通过学习如何设计和实施算法,培养逻辑思维能力和解决问题的能力。
-
学习编程语言:选择适合儿童的编程语言,如Scratch、Blockly等。这些语言以图形化的方式表示代码,使学习过程更加有趣和直观。
-
进行简单的编程实践:通过编写简单的程序来实践所学的概念和语法。从简单的动画开始,逐渐增加难度和复杂度。
-
学习基本算法:了解常用的算法,如排序、查找和递归等。通过实践和练习,掌握这些算法的基本原理和实现方法。
-
解决问题:鼓励孩子通过编程解决实际问题。可以给他们一些简单的项目,如制作一个游戏或设计一个交互式故事。
-
进一步学习其他编程语言:一旦孩子掌握了基本的编程概念和技巧,可以尝试学习其他更高级的编程语言,如Python或JavaScript等。
-
参加编程俱乐部或训练营:加入一个编程俱乐部或报名参加编程训练营,与其他有相同兴趣爱好的孩子一起学习和分享经验。
总之,儿童编程的学习需循序渐进,从基础的概念和语法开始,逐步深入,并通过实践和解决问题来巩固所学内容。这样的学习方法可以帮助儿童建立坚实的编程基础,同时培养他们的创造力和解决问题能力。
1年前 -